> Thanks all for the help, I solved in this way:
Are you telling us that now transactions are working properly?
> 1) I move the code form the controller to the model. (I don't really
> know if this help!)
> 2) I used the Datasource to start the transaction. (Like explained in
> the docs)
> 3) I commit or rollback with the datasource, but the SQLLog in the
> page shows only the query, and no trace of the transaction SQL code.
That's strange even if I think it is possible cakephp will not log
everything; however, maybe some cakephp-sql expert guys would shed
some light on the subject.
Matteo
>
> Code:
>
> inside the Model
> <?php
> [...]
>
> $ds = this->getDataSource();
> $ds->begin($this);
> $result = $this->saveAssociated('params');
> if ($result) {
> $ds->commit($this); // in the doc there are no trace of this, that
> i have to pass like parameter the refernce to $this.
> } else {
> $ds->rollback($this);
> }
> ?>
